Summary

A highly skilled and results-driven professional with extensive experience in econometric modeling, research analytics, and data analysis. Adept at applying advanced statistical techniques and econometric models to uncover insights, optimize decision-making, and solve complex business and economic problems. Proficient in a wide range of analytical tools and software, including Stata, EViews, Matlab, Python, R, and SPSS, to conduct robust quantitative analysis, simulation, and forecasting. Strong background in working with large datasets, performing econometric testing, and generating actionable recommendations for both academic and industry applications. Demonstrated ability to communicate complex findings clearly and effectively to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.

Director

FTI Consulting
09.2015 - 10.2016
  • Conducted economic and quantitative expert analyses to clients involved in litigation, arbitration, and other contexts where parties are engaged in complex business disputes
  • Served as expert econometrician in a lawsuit between Louis Dreyfus Commodities BV vs Glencore Xstrata over alleged manipulation of cotton prices in violation of the Commodities Exchange Act
  • Officiated as a health economist and statistical sampling expert in a large healthcare litigation matter for the Medicare/Medicaid Reimbursement program and some other major pharmaceutical disputes
  • Derived econometric models to support alleged infringement of Intellectual Property, including patents, trademarks, trade secrets, and copyrights
  • Mentored an analytic team of five economists with advanced analytics and econometric modeling expertise
